3. Q: My HP Pavilion G6 is not recognizing external displays connected via VGA, what can I do to fix this?
A: If your HP Pavilion G6 is not recognizing external displays connected via VGA, you can follow these troubleshooting steps. First, ensure that the VGA cable is securely connected to the laptop and the external display. Then, try pressing the "Windows key" + "P" on your keyboard to open the Windows Projection settings. From there, you can select the appropriate display mode (e.g., "Duplicate," "Extend," etc.) to enable the external display. If the issue persists, try updating the VGA driver to the latest version compatible with Windows 10 64-bit.
